название
Что такое Segregated Witness?

Что такое Segregated Witness?

FAQ

Segregated Witness (SegWit) – модификация (мод) протокола типа софтфорк, которая была создана специалистами, некогда разработавшими популярный клиент сети Bitcoin Core.

Данный мод успешно проявил себя в работе с оптимизацией размера блока в общей цепочке, что положительно отразилось на решении вопроса о расширении масштаба сети Биткойн и скорости проведения операций. Получается, что Segregated Witness является лидером среди модификаций софтфорка. Подобные моды увеличивают эффективность работы сети блокчейна.

Софтворк: в чем суть?

Софтфорк – модифицированный набор правил в протоколе цепочки блоков. Софтфорк осуществляет «мягкую» поправку кода, при этом не затрагивая основу программного обеспечения. Альтернативой этому софтфорку выступает радикальная модификация хардфорк. Хардфорк – это более быстрое решение той же задачи, но при этом существенно повышается риск поставить под угрозу выполнение всего протокола.

В чем особенности мода?

Пожалуй, все, кто сталкивался на практике с работой SegWit, согласятся, что ее главная «фишка» заключается в эффективности увеличения размера блоков биткоина. Это означает, что каждый блок в цепи будет иметь возможность нести больше информации о транзакциях. Другими словами, пропускная способность блокчейна станет значительно выше.

Со своей задачей мод справляется довольно элегантно - извлекает полученные подписи операций в блоке и размещает их в специальной строке данных. Таким образом, во время удаления подписи транзакции модификация мгновенно обращается к данным о записи и уменьшает размер операции. В этом сложно поверить, но благодаря этой схеме, размер транзакции уменьшается почти в два раза. В результате полученного преимущества, нет необходимости в создании дополнительных блоков, ведь уже имеющиеся могут вместить в себя удвоенный объем транзакций.

Какая польза от мода SegWit?

Как уже было сказано, данный мод, в основном, внедряется в сеть блокчейн для ее оптимизации и масштабирования. Этот мод быстро и эффективно решает проблему с оптимизацией таких задач, как разделение подписей операций от процесса их отправки и получения. Таким образом, операции с криптовалютой перестанут занимать много места, а блоки, в свою очередь, станут вместительнее в два раза. SegWit также воздействует на увеличение скорости в блокчейн-сети. Более высокая скорость в сети означает, что транзакции будут происходить быстрее и без «лагов». Улучшение скорости обрабатываемых данных происходит из-за слияния этого мода и полезной программки Lightning Network.

Как внедрить мод в блокчейн Биткойн?

Изначально, чтобы активировать внедрение в децентрализованную сеть, понадобятся активные действия от примерно 95% участников сети (то есть майнеров). Иными словами, чтобы модификация успешно прошла процесс внедрения, администратору сети после ее активации необходимо удостовериться в ее необходимости. Для этого в течение 15 дней хотя бы 95% от 2016 блоков должны обрабатываться исключительно усилиями майнеров. В итоге, мод Segregated Witness получит сигнал о поддержке и будет одобрен всей сетью.

10.03.2018 / 17:33 Лера Суханова
Что такое Proof-of-Work и Proof-of-Stake? Что такое Proof-of-Work и Proof-of-Stake?
Proof-of-Stake (PoS) и Proof-of-Work (PoW) являются специальными алгоритмами консенсуса (то есть соглашения)...
ТОП-5 самых известных форков Биткойн ТОП-5 самых известных форков Биткойн
Биткойн – первая в мире криптовалюта или цифровый актив на децентрализованной технологии блокчейна. Однако с течением времени у «патриарха» всех..
Что такое форк? Что такое форк?
Чтобы выяснить, что же такое форк, стоит сперва вспомнить, что представляет собой Биткойн...
Комментарии (0)
Добавить комментарий
Прокомментировать
Войти через: